Why are topics I bring up to chatGPT suddenly showing up as ads on YouTube? by OkFeedback9127 in ChatGPT

[–]EstateTerrible4807 0 points1 point  (0 children)

People are just scraping what chatgpt is searching for in the source section of the browser and are running custom intent tactics for youtube and search ads. That’s actually pretty convenient. Moreover chatgpt still runs maybe 60 - 70% of its volumes on chrome. Don’t think it’s rocket science. It’s funny how the every prompt and every reply by chatgpt is enriching google’s algorithm.

CTV campaigns best practices by Extension-Sweet-3817 in programmatic

[–]EstateTerrible4807 2 points3 points  (0 children)

CTV is never about actionable metrics using which you can write a fantastic report to impress clients. User behaviour has still not moved to a point where people are taking their phones out to scan a QR CODE while the ad plays. Until then, it is an excellent channel for awareness. Your audience structure must always be dependent on the CTV partner you choose.

  1. Have a good long conversation with your CTV partner to know what kinda 1st party audiences they've got.

  2. Learn to assert your needs to them and not make it easier for them to just dump any audiences in the deal.

  3. Try to target specific lineups of shows, events etc. if the partner has supporting metrics from previous runs or a case study that's great.

Bottom line - CTV is still more like linear cable tv. The only difference being you get to choose the lineups efficiently and add a layer of audience data if the partner has that ability built into their systems. Think like an offline marketer when you do CTV.
